Muntajab al-Din b. Babawayh

Delving into the intricacies of his jurisprudential thought, we discover that Muntajab al-Din b. Babawayh positioned himself as a synthesizer of knowledge, bridging the gaps between the authoritative texts of the Qur’an and the hadith. His methodical approach not only adhered to Scripture’s textuality but also acknowledged the necessity of contextual interpretation. By establishing a dialogical relationship with prior scholars, he invigorated the fiqh discourse, thus enabling a more adaptable legal framework that could respond to emerging societal needs. Consequently, Babawayh’s methodology invites aspiring scholars to engage critically with traditional texts and consider their application in contemporary settings.

Another compelling facet of Babawayh’s legacy rests in his discussions on epistemology. He underscored the notion that knowledge is not merely a collection of facts; instead, it is an experiential journey leading to spiritual enlightenment. This philosophical approach serves to bridge the often-perceived chasm between intellectual pursuits and spiritual fulfillment. His assertions challenge individuals to pursue knowledge with the intent of transformation — both personally and communally.

This notion of transformation is interwoven with the existential themes present in Babawayh’s writings. The Shia belief that the Imam plays a vital role in the spiritual progression of the community accentuates the importance of the Imam’s enlightened guidance. Muntajab al-Din b. Babawayh elaborated on the concept of occultation, engaging with the esoteric dimensions of Imamate. His assertions invite adherents to ponder the implications of this mystical experience, prompting reflections on the nature of faith, expectation, and divine support. Engaging with such themes paves the way for an enriched spiritual inquiry.
